Re: Infinite Key Retention & Board Removal XTS5k

FIPS mode is optional. Enabling Key Loss Key Generation and IKR makes the modules non-FIPS compliant because it *does* allow you to remove the module without losing the keys. IKR off = keys lost when board removed. IKR on - keys retained when board removed. I have done this on ASTRO Saber with a UC...

Re: 800 MHZ Trunking RSSI

RSSI Acceptable Threshold : The factory default = 34
RSSI Good Threshold : The factory default = 40
RSSI Very Good Threshold : The factory default = 46
RSSI Excellent Threshold : The factory default = 4D for system version 6.3 and above, The factory default = 46 for system version 6.2
